Subject: [PATCH iwl-next v1 2/2] igc: use napi_schedule_irqoff() instead of napi_schedule()

Replace napi_schedule() with napi_schedule_irqoff() 
in the interrupt handler path in igc driver
Tested on Intel Corporation Ethernet Controller I226-V.

 drivers/net/ethernet/intel/igc/igc_main.c | 6 +++---
 1 file changed, 3 insertions(+), 3 deletions(-)

diff --git a/drivers/net/ethernet/intel/igc/igc_main.c b/drivers/net/ethernet/intel/igc/igc_main.c
index 72bc5128d8b8..712605886104 100644
--- a/drivers/net/ethernet/intel/igc/igc_main.c
+++ b/drivers/net/ethernet/intel/igc/igc_main.c
@@ -5688,7 +5688,7 @@ static irqreturn_t igc_msix_ring(int irq, void *data)
 	/* Write the ITR value calculated from the previous interrupt. */
 	igc_write_itr(q_vector);
 
-	napi_schedule(&q_vector->napi);
+	napi_schedule_irqoff(&q_vector->napi);
 
 	return IRQ_HANDLED;
 }
@@ -6059,7 +6059,7 @@ static irqreturn_t igc_intr_msi(int irq, void *data)
 	if (icr & IGC_ICR_TS)
 		igc_tsync_interrupt(adapter);
 
-	napi_schedule(&q_vector->napi);
+	napi_schedule_irqoff(&q_vector->napi);
 
 	return IRQ_HANDLED;
 }
@@ -6105,7 +6105,7 @@ static irqreturn_t igc_intr(int irq, void *data)
 	if (icr & IGC_ICR_TS)
 		igc_tsync_interrupt(adapter);
 
-	napi_schedule(&q_vector->napi);
+	napi_schedule_irqoff(&q_vector->napi);
 
 	return IRQ_HANDLED;
 }
